ICSE Chemistry Exam 2026 Important Topics For Last Minute Practice 

High-Weightage Chapters 

Students can prioritise these topics to score well in the exam. Here you can find mark distribution as per topic distribution. 

1. Compounds: (Carries 15-20 Marks) This is the largest unit. Concentrate on the laboratory preparation, collection methods, and specific reactions for ammonia (Haber's Process), nitric acid (Ostwald Process), HCl, and sulphuric acid (Contact Process).

2. Organic Chemistry: (Carries 12-15 marks) Understand IUPAC nomenclature, structural formulas (up to 5 carbons), and major reactions (addition, substitution, and combustion) of alkanes, alkenes, and alkynes.

3. Mole Concept & Stoichiometry: (Carries 10-12 Marks) Solve numerical problems using Gay-Lussac's Law, Avogadro's Law, and determining empirical and molecular formulas.

Important Topics For Last Minute Practice

Students can use this distribution shared in a table to help prepare for the upcoming exam and use it for quick revision of these key topics. 

Chapter

Must-Know Concepts

Periodic Table

Trends in atomic size, ionization potential, electron affinity, and electronegativity (across periods and down groups).

Chemical Bonding

Electron dot structures for ionic (NaCl, MgCl2, CaO) and covalent compounds.

Electrolysis

Detailed study of molten Lead Bromide, acidified water, and aqueous Copper Sulphate (with active/inert electrodes). Memorize observations at the cathode and anode.

Analytical Chemistry

Distinctive tests for cations using Sodium Hydroxide and Ammonium Hydroxide.

Metallurgy

The extraction of Aluminium (Hall-Héroult process) and common alloys like Solder, Brass, and Bronze.
